    • PURPOSE:To control vibration produced in a long bolt by compressing and deforming a tubular vibration control member which is longer than an insertion hole for the bolt and inserted between the bolt and the insertion hole with a gap by screwing the bolt, to be brought into contact with the outer peripheral surface of the bolt and the inner wall surface of the insertion hole. CONSTITUTION:A stud bolt 1 is inserted in an insertion hole 4 formed in a cylinder head 2 and a cylinder block 3, so that both the cylinder head 2 and the cylinder block 3 are fastened to a crank case 5 and fixed thereto. A vibration control member 6 is inserted in the insertion hole 4. The vibration control member 6 is a metallic thin wall tubular member a little longer than the insertion hole and inserted between the stud bolt 1 and the insertion hole 4 with a gap. When the stud bolt 1 is screwed in, a slidng curved portion 7 is compressed and deformed, so that bending lines P1, P3 are brought into contact with the outer peripheral surface of the stud bolt 1 and a bending line P2 is brought into contact with the inner wall surface, whereby the vibration of the stud bolt can be controlled.
    • 目的:通过压缩和变形长度大于螺栓插入孔的管状振动控制构件来控制在长螺栓中产生的振动,通过螺栓拧入插入螺栓和插入孔之间的间隙,使其进入 与螺栓的外周表面和插入孔的内壁表面接触。 构成:将双头螺栓1插入到形成在气缸盖2和气缸体3中的插入孔4中,使得气缸盖2和气缸体3都被紧固到曲轴箱5并固定在其上。 振动控制构件6插入插入孔4中。振动控制构件6是比插入孔稍长的金属薄壁管状构件,并且间隔地插入在双头螺栓1和插入孔4之间。 当双头螺栓1旋入时,滑动弯曲部分7被压缩和变形,使得弯曲线P1,P3与双头螺栓1的外周表面接触,并且弯曲线P2与 内壁表面,从而可以控制双头螺栓的振动。
